Bien sûr ! Voici une introduction généraliste sur le sujet de la preuve à divulgation nulle de connaissance, avec cinq mots en gras :

La preuve à divulgation nulle de connaissance est un concept essentiel dans le domaine de la crypto. Elle désigne une méthode cryptographique permettant à une partie de prouver qu’elle possède certaines informations sans révéler ces informations elles-mêmes. Cette technique garantit ainsi la confidentialité tout en assurant l’authenticité et l’intégrité des échanges. Grâce à des protocoles sophistiqués, les preuves à divulgation nulle de connaissance sont utilisées dans de nombreux domaines, tels que les paiements sécurisés, l’identification numérique et la protection des données sensibles. Avec leur capacité à renforcer la confiance et à préserver la vie privée, ces preuves font partie intégrante de l’écosystème cryptographique moderne.

La preuve à divulgation nulle de connaissance : Une avancée crypto révolutionnaire

La preuve à divulgation nulle de connaissance : Une avancée crypto révolutionnaire

La preuve à divulgation nulle de connaissance, également connue sous le nom de z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Argument of Knowledge), est une avancée crypto révolutionnaire qui offre de nombreux avantages. Cette technologie permet de prouver la validité d’une information sans avoir à révéler les détails sensibles qui lui sont associés.

Confidentialité renforcée

L’un des principaux avantages de la preuve à divulgation nulle de connaissance est sa capacité à renforcer la confidentialité des données. En utilisant cette technologie, il devient possible de prouver que l’on possède une information spécifique sans avoir à la divulguer. Cela est particulièrement utile dans le domaine des transactions financières, où la protection des informations sensibles est cruciale.

Sécurité améliorée

En plus de renforcer la confidentialité des données, la preuve à divulgation nulle de connaissance contribue également à améliorer la sécurité des transactions. Grâce à cette technologie, il devient extrêmement difficile voire impossible pour un attaquant d’intercepter ou de modifier les informations échangées. Cela permet de réduire considérablement les risques de fraude et de piratage.

Efficacité accrue

Une autre caractéristique importante de la preuve à divulgation nulle de connaissance est son efficacité. Cette technologie permet de générer des preuves de manière succincte, ce qui signifie qu’elles sont beaucoup plus rapides à vérifier que les méthodes traditionnelles. Cela ouvre de nouvelles possibilités dans de nombreux domaines, tels que les paiements en ligne, où la rapidité des transactions est cruciale.

Applications diverses

Enfin, la preuve à divulgation nulle de connaissance offre de nombreuses applications pratiques. Elle peut être utilisée dans les protocoles de confidentialité des crypto-monnaies, les systèmes de vote électronique sécurisés, les contrats intelligents et bien d’autres domaines encore. Cette technologie prometteuse ouvre la voie à de nouvelles innovations et opportunités dans le domaine de la crypto.

En conclusion, la preuve à divulgation nulle de connaissance est une avancée crypto révolutionnaire qui offre des avantages significatifs en termes de confidentialité, de sécurité, d’efficacité et d’applications diverses. Son utilisation croissante dans différents domaines témoigne de son potentiel pour transformer la façon dont nous interagissons avec les données sensibles.

Qu’est-ce que la preuve à divulgation nulle de connaissance (ZKP) et pourquoi est-elle importante dans le domaine de la crypto-monnaie?

La preuve à divulgation nulle de connaissance (Zero-Knowledge Proof ou ZKP en anglais) est un concept clé dans le domaine de la crypto-monnaie. Elle permet de prouver qu’une déclaration est vraie sans révéler l’information sous-jacente qui prouve cette vérité. En d’autres termes, il est possible de prouver que l’on connaît certaines informations sans les révéler.

Cela est particulièrement important dans le domaine de la crypto-monnaie pour plusieurs raisons. Tout d’abord, cela permet de protéger la vie privée des utilisateurs. En utilisant une ZKP, il est possible de prouver la validité d’une transaction sans révéler les détails spécifiques de cette transaction. Cela garantit que les utilisateurs peuvent effectuer des transactions confidentielles sans craindre une divulgation non autorisée de leurs informations personnelles.

De plus, les preuves à divulgation nulle de connaissance sont essentielles pour prouver l’intégrité des données dans un système décentralisé. Par exemple, dans le cadre des contrats intelligents basés sur la technologie de la blockchain, il est crucial de pouvoir prouver que certaines conditions sont remplies sans exposer les informations sensibles. Les ZKP permettent de réaliser cela de manière sécurisée et efficace.

Enfin, les preuves à divulgation nulle de connaissance jouent un rôle clé dans la vérification et la validation des transactions. Elles permettent de s’assurer de manière cryptographique que les transactions sont valides et conformes aux règles du protocole sans avoir à révéler toutes les informations associées à ces transactions.

En résumé, la preuve à divulgation nulle de connaissance est un outil puissant dans le domaine de la crypto-monnaie. Elle protège la vie privée des utilisateurs, garantit l’intégrité des données et facilite la vérification des transactions. C’est pourquoi elle est considérée comme un élément essentiel dans le développement et l’adoption des technologies de crypto-monnaie.

Comment fonctionne une ZKP et quelles sont les différentes techniques utilisées pour construire des protocoles ZKP efficaces?

Une preuve à divulgation nulle, ou ZKP (Zero Knowledge Proof en anglais), est un protocole cryptographique qui permet à une partie, appelée le prouveur, de démontrer la validité d’une affirmation à une autre partie, appelée le vérificateur, sans révéler l’information confidentielle sous-jacente. Cela signifie que le prouveur peut prouver qu’il connaît une information sans avoir à la divulguer.

Les ZKP sont largement utilisées dans le domaine de la cryptographie pour garantir la confidentialité tout en permettant la vérification des informations. Le concept clé des ZKP est qu’elles doivent être interactives, c’est-à-dire qu’il doit y avoir des échanges entre le prouveur et le vérificateur.

Il existe plusieurs techniques pour construire des protocoles ZKP efficaces. Voici quelques-unes des plus couramment utilisées :

1. Protocoles de connaissance à divulgation nulle :
– Protocole de Schnorr : Ce protocole permet au prouveur de prouver qu’il connaît un témoin sans révéler le témoin lui-même.
– Protocole de Fiat-Shamir : Dans ce protocole, le prouveur communique avec le vérificateur en utilisant uniquement des calculs cryptographiques, éliminant ainsi la nécessité d’une interaction réelle. C’est aussi appelé une preuve non interactive à divulgation nulle.

2. Protocoles de preuve de connaissance :
– Protocole de preuve à divulgation nulle à divulgation nulle (zk-SNARKs) : Cette technique est utilisée pour prouver la validité d’une affirmation sans divulguer les détails spécifiques de cette affirmation. C’est la technique utilisée par la blockchain Zcash pour garantir la confidentialité des transactions.
– Protocole de preuve du graphe de connaissance (zk-STARKs) : Cette technique permet de prouver que le prouveur connaît une information sans divulguer cette information. zk-STARKs est considéré comme plus sûr que zk-SNARKs, mais il est également plus complexe à mettre en œuvre.

Ces techniques peuvent être utilisées pour construire une variété de protocoles ZKP efficaces dans différents contextes cryptographiques, tels que les systèmes de vote électronique, les protocoles d’authentification et la vérification décentralisée des connaissances.

Quelles sont les applications pratiques des protocoles ZKP dans le domaine de la crypto-monnaie et comment peuvent-ils améliorer la confidentialité et la sécurité des transactions?

Les protocoles de preuve à divulgation nulle de connaissance (ZKP) jouent un rôle crucial dans la crypto-monnaie en améliorant à la fois la confidentialité et la sécurité des transactions. Voici quelques applications pratiques des protocoles ZKP dans ce domaine :

1. Confidentialité des transactions : L’une des utilisations les plus courantes des protocoles ZKP est d’assurer la confidentialité des transactions. Les protocoles ZKP permettent aux utilisateurs de prouver qu’ils possèdent une certaine information sans révéler cette information précise. Par exemple, dans le cas des transactions de crypto-monnaie, un protocole ZKP peut être utilisé pour prouver que l’on possède suffisamment de fonds pour effectuer une transaction, sans révéler le montant exact des fonds.

2. Vérification des transactions : Les protocoles ZKP peuvent également être utilisés pour vérifier l’exactitude des transactions, sans exposer les détails spécifiques des transactions. Cela permet de s’assurer que les transactions sont valides et qu’il n’y a pas de double dépense, sans divulguer les informations sensibles telles que les adresses des expéditeurs et des destinataires.

3. Confidentialité des soldes : Les protocoles ZKP peuvent être utilisés pour prouver un solde de compte sans révéler le montant exact du solde. Cela garantit que les informations financières sensibles restent confidentielles tout en permettant aux parties d’effectuer des transactions en toute sécurité.

4. Authentification sans divulgation : Les protocoles ZKP peuvent également être utilisés pour prouver l’authenticité d’une personne ou d’une entité sans révéler d’informations personnelles sensibles. Cela peut être utile dans des cas tels que l’inscription à une plateforme de trading de crypto-monnaie, où l’on doit prouver son identité sans divulguer des détails tels que son nom complet ou sa date de naissance.

En utilisant les protocoles ZKP, les transactions de crypto-monnaie peuvent bénéficier d’une confidentialité renforcée, car elles permettent aux utilisateurs de prouver certaines informations sans les révéler. Cela garantit également la sécurité des transactions en évitant les problèmes tels que la double dépense ou l’usurpation d’identité. En conclusion, les protocoles ZKP sont essentiels pour améliorer la confidentialité et la sécurité des transactions de crypto-monnaie.

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*